Randy Orton On Why He's Going To Saudi Arabia: "I've Got 5 Kids. I Gotta Go Make That Dollar"

Randy Orton comments once again on WWE going to Saudi Arabia.

Earlier this month, Orton, speaking to TMZ, defended WWE's decision to go to Saudi Arabia for Crown Jewel by saying, "The only way to help with the change over there and to not cancel the trip. Our girls performed in Abu Dhabi not too long ago and I think we'll be there eventually with Saudi and Crown Jewel. That's the goal to make things better everywhere. Not going, doesn't help. Going helps."

TMZ caught up with Orton once more as he was boarding his plane to head to Saudi Arabia. After commenting about the "long flight" and "shitty airplane food," Orton revealed why he decided to make the trip over to Saudi Arabia for Crown Jewel.

"I've got five kids. I gotta go make that dollar. They want me in Saudi, I'm going to Saudi."

When asked about John Cena and his decision to pull out of the event, Orton was unaware that Cena had done so. 

"Does he still wrestle? I didn't know he pulled out."

Cena was originally scheduled to compete alongside Orton in the WWE World Cup. However, due to his refusal to go, Cena was taken out of the tournament and replaced by Bobby Lashley. Orton will face Rey Mysterio in the first round of the WWE World Cup this Friday at Crown Jewel.
